About the job

We are partnering with an international manufacturing firm to hire a Lead AI Scientist to drive the development and adoption of AI capabilities across the business.

This is a high-impact leadership role focused on applying Artificial Intelligence, Machine Learning, and Generative / Agentic AI to solve complex operational and commercial challenges across manufacturing, supply chain, engineering, quality, maintenance, and production functions. You will work closely with business and technology stakeholders to identify opportunities, develop AI solutions, and drive measurable business outcomes at scale.

Responsibilities

You will lead the development and deployment of AI and advanced analytics solutions across the organisation, translating business priorities into scalable AI use cases that improve operational efficiency, productivity, quality, and decision-making.

Working closely with stakeholders across Manufacturing, Engineering, Supply Chain, Quality, Operations Excellence, Procurement, and Technology, you will identify high-value opportunities where AI can create competitive advantage. Key initiatives may include predictive maintenance, computer vision, quality inspection, demand forecasting, process optimisation, digital twins, intelligent automation, and Generative AI-enabled productivity solutions.

You will be responsible for driving AI strategy, overseeing model development and deployment, establishing best practices in AI engineering and governance, and ensuring successful adoption across the organisation. As a senior leader, you will also mentor and develop a team of Data Scientists, AI Engineers, and Analytics professionals.

Requirements

We are seeking an experienced AI leader with a strong track record of delivering AI, Machine Learning, and advanced analytics solutions within complex enterprise environments.

Candidates should possess expertise in machine learning, statistical modelling, predictive analytics, computer vision, Generative AI, and modern data platforms, with experience deploying solutions into production environments. Experience leading AI teams and driving cross-functional transformation initiatives will be highly advantageous.

Experience within manufacturing or other asset-intensive industries is preferred. Candidates from adjacent sectors with strong experience applying AI to operational and business challenges are also encouraged to apply.

The successful candidate will demonstrate strong stakeholder management capabilities, commercial acumen, and the ability to bridge business and technology teams to deliver measurable impact through AI.
